Understanding the Concept of a Minor DEMAT Account

A DEMAT account for a minor is essentially a digital holding facility for securities. Since a person under eighteen is not legally permitted to trade independently, the account is managed by a natural or court-appointed guardian. This setup allows the minor to own shares, but the responsibility for the account’s integrity and operation lies with the adult.

The primary purpose of this arrangement is to hold investments rather than engage in active day-to-day trading. It serves as a digital vault where equity, mutual funds, and government bonds can be stored safely. The account remains under the guardian’s supervision until the minor attains the age of majority. This structure protects the minor while allowing their portfolio to benefit from market movements over several years.

The Role of the Guardian in the Application Process

A minor cannot open DEMAT account on their own. A guardian must step in to facilitate the process. This guardian is usually a parent, but in certain cases, it can be a legal representative appointed by a court. The guardian’s credentials are used to verify the legitimacy of the application and to provide a point of contact for all regulatory communications.

The guardian acts as the operator of the account. They are responsible for all the paperwork and the digital signatures required during the setup. Because the minor does not have a regular income, the guardian’s financial profile is often used as a reference point for the initial requirements. The guardian must ensure that the funds used for investments are from legitimate sources and that the account is used solely for the benefit of the minor.

Essential Documents Needed to Open DEMAT Account for Minors

To ensure a smooth application, several documents must be kept ready. First and foremost is the proof of age for the minor, which is typically a birth certificate. This establishes the identity of the child and confirms their status as a minor. Without this, the specific minor-category account cannot be processed.

The guardian must provide their own identification and address proof for verification. Additionally, the minor’s own tax identification number is now a mandatory requirement for opening the account. While the minor does not pay taxes on these holdings directly, the identification is used for tracking the investments within the national financial system. Proof of address and photographs of both the minor and the guardian are also standard requirements. Having these documents digitized can speed up the online application process significantly.

Step-by-Step Guide to the Registration Process

The process begins by selecting a registered participant that offers minor account services. You will need to fill out a specific application form that includes sections for both the child and the guardian. It is important to ensure that the names match the official documents exactly to avoid any rejection during the verification phase.

Once the form is submitted along with the necessary documents, a verification process is conducted. This might involve a short video call or an in-person visit to confirm the identities of the applicants. After the verification is successful, the account is activated. The guardian receives the login credentials, which are usually linked to their own registered mobile number and email address for security purposes. This ensures that the guardian is alerted to any activity within the account.

Operational Restrictions on Minor Accounts

It is crucial to understand that a minor DEMAT account has certain limitations. The account is intended for investment purposes only. This means that speculative activities like intraday trading or dealing in complex derivatives are strictly prohibited. The focus is purely on delivery-based investments where the assets are held for the long term.

Furthermore, the minor cannot be a joint holder in the account. The account must be held solely in the name of the minor with the guardian as the sole signatory. These restrictions are in place to protect the minor from the high risks associated with short-term market volatility. The goal is to build a stable portfolio rather than chasing quick profits through risky maneuvers.

Transitioning the Account Once the Minor Turns Eighteen

When the minor reaches the age of eighteen, the account does not automatically become a regular trading account. A fresh application must be submitted to update the status of the account holder. The now-adult individual must complete a new verification process using their own credentials, signatures, and updated photographs.

The guardian’s role is officially terminated at this stage. The individual will then have full control over the assets and can engage in all types of trading activities if they choose to do so. This transition is a significant milestone that marks the beginning of their independent financial journey. It is the moment when the years of disciplined investing finally pass into the hands of the person for whom the wealth was built.
